最近真的是忙疯了,不仅是工作上面的一直处于比较忙的状态,还有就是在工作上面需要有一些新的技术方案实现,需要去学习对应的使用,以及他实现的底层的原理,才能够把这些工具用好。
当前项目是直接面向交易数据,其计算的可靠性,可用性的有很强的要求,因此在实现底层方面需要深入的了解写出来的代码,或使用是什么样的第三方服务,才敢把它放到服务器上面去跑。
因此这段时间除了正常的加班加点工作,工作之外还一直都在学习,耳机里一直都听着专业相关的音频,当然也一直使用的2倍速度,不管是上下班的通勤时间,还是一个人吃饭走路的时候。
当前所使用的方案是大数据流计算,需要引入的一系列的第三方组件,慢慢的从一个只会做点需求分析,写点CURD业务代码的人,慢慢的转型来做大数据相关的全家桶,要恶补的东西还真不少。
为了快速学习核心内容,从整体了解方案端到端的技术栈,基本都是用2倍速度,在4月份,以及五一假期,听完了4门课程,粗略统计每个音频如果10分钟一个课程40个,那么有近1600分钟,近27小时。然后再做了整个课程做成xmind思维导图笔记,以此来把多个作者的多年经验总结快速提炼出来,当然目前只整理了一部分,还有很多内容需要学、笔记需要整理。
同时年初为了提升自己的专业技能,想把数据结构和算法再学习一下,考个公司的认证。在某APP上面报了一个算法训练营,视频跟着一位高级算法工程师进行学习,每周提交对应的作业。
开始还把这件事情当做业余最重要的事来做,还买了一个笔记本记录,记录每天学习的内容。最开始的计划是每天攻克一个算法题,然后把算法代码写到用日期标记的笔记本上,然后每天反复的去看,把这些常用的算法弄清楚。但是因为做的事情太多,这件事情也没有做下去了。
有时候想着,工作之外还做了这么多事,感觉还是收获很大的,之前一直觉得工作上,一个接触一个新项目,感觉什么都不懂。但是快速的学习了大量知识之后,再和周边的同事交流,发现别人讲的东西,基本都能听懂,还能在某些细节上给出更确定性的结论和更好的方案时,这个正反馈真不错。
想到乔布斯的一次发言:
How do you know what's the right direction?
Ultimately it comes down to taste.
It comes down to taste.
It ’ s a matter of trying to expose yourself to the best things that humans have done .
And then try to bring those things into what you are doing .
Picasso had a saying ,
“ Good artists copy , great artists steal .”
We have always been shameless about stealing great ideas .
网友评论